Türkiye’s Machinery Exports Reach a Record USD 28.7 Billion in 2025

Despite slowing global trade and rising protectionist pressures, Türkiye’s machinery industry achieved a historic export performance in 2025. The sector continues to strengthen its position through higher value-added products, diversified export markets, and a structural shift toward modernization and advanced engineering.

Machinery Exports of Türkiye Reach an All-Time High

In 2025, Türkiye’s machinery industry achieved a historic export record, demonstrating resilience despite a challenging global economic environment marked by weak growth, slowing trade flows, rising protectionism, and increasing tariff barriers.

Türkiye’s total exports grew by 4.5% year-on-year to USD 273.4 billion. Machinery exports, including free zones, increased by 1.9% to USD 28.7 billion — the highest level ever recorded for the sector.

Although export volumes declined in physical terms, the average export price reached a record USD 8.1 per kilogram, reflecting a strategic shift toward higher value-added and more technologically advanced products.

Key Markets and Product Categories

Germany remained the largest export destination, with shipments rising by 6.8% to USD 3.2 billion. Exports to the United States increased by 9%, approaching USD 2 billion. Notable growth was also observed in neighboring and regional markets, including a sharp increase in exports to Syria.

The strongest export growth was recorded in:

  • internal combustion engines and components;
  • construction and mining machinery;
  • household appliances such as washing and drying machines.

Significant increases were also seen in turbines, turbojet engines, hydraulic systems, and food processing machinery.

Value-Oriented Export Strategy

Industry representatives report that export revenues were sustained despite cost pressures, volatile global demand, and tight domestic monetary conditions. This performance was largely driven by a focus on high-engineering-content products with higher margins and lower after-sales service intensity.

However, structural challenges remain. Annual machinery imports exceeded USD 45 billion, indicating continued pressure from imports and limited effectiveness of existing domestic protection mechanisms.

Market Diversification and Investment Trends

Demand for machinery in Europe remains subdued, while most new orders are coming from outside the euro area, particularly in defense, infrastructure, and energy projects. This has reinforced the importance of market diversification and engagement not only with the EU but also with its partner countries.

Globally, investment trends in machinery are shifting away from building new capacity toward upgrading existing equipment — improving efficiency, intelligence, and flexibility. As a result, service, modernization, and retrofitting activities are becoming increasingly important.

For foreign entrepreneurs and investors operating in or considering entry into Türkiye, the machinery sector continues to stand out as one of the country’s most resilient and strategically significant export industries.

At the same time, the machinery industry is undergoing a structural transformation. Global investment is increasingly shifting away from the creation of new production capacities toward the modernization of existing equipment, with a focus on higher technological content, automation, and efficiency. Defense- and infrastructure-related projects remain an important source of support for the sector, contributing to the development of advanced engineering capabilities and related industrial segments.

Against the backdrop of rising imports and continued pressure on the domestic market, competitiveness has become a multidimensional issue encompassing industrial policy, financial conditions, and the protection of local production chains. Under these conditions, the machinery industry continues to play a key role in Türkiye’s export structure, providing a foundation for further technological advancement and deeper integration into international manufacturing and investment networks.
